Data Domain: MTREE-replikering viser feil Bytes_remaining under initialisering
Summary: MTREE-replikering viser feil bytes_remaining under initialisering.
Symptoms
MTREE-replikering viser feil byte under initialiseringsprosessen for gamle MTREEer som aldri ble brukt under replikering.
The following MTREE has been used [# mtree list]: /data/col1/support 5965.4 RW
Statistikk viser 92 TB gjenværende data etter at du har opprettet en ny MTREE-replikering ved hjelp av trinnene ovenfor:
# replication show detailed-stats rctx://1
CTX:1 Destination: mtree://dd-dr.support.com/data/col1/support Network bytes sent to destination: 2,287,577,928 Pre-compressed bytes written to source: 92,046,090,413,266 Pre-compressed bytes sent to destination: 2,860,770,559 Bytes after synthetic optimization: 2,860,770,559 Bytes after filtering by destination: 2,253,845,068 Bytes after low bandwidth optimization: 2,253,845,068 Bytes after local compression: 2,258,791,288 Pre-compressed bytes remaining: 92,043,229,642,707 <---- Compression ratio: 1.3 Sync'ed-as-of time: (initializing)
Mens underliggende registernøkler viser mer nøyaktige byte:
repl.001.src_host = dd-prod.support.com repl.001.src_path = /data/col1/support repl.001.dst_host = dd-dr.support.com repl.001.dst_path = /data/col1/support repl.001.progress.task_name = initializing 3/3 repl.001.progress.init_vbytes = 5991145719813 <---
Fra ddfs.info:
Initial virtuelle byte estimering ser OK:
09/21 10:58:45.157 (tid 0x2b0e208796e0): repl ctx 1: mrepl_create_init_snap creating initial snapshot. 09/21 10:58:48.068 (tid 0x2b0e208796e0): repl ctx 1: estimating init vbytes as 5991145719813 09/21 10:58:48.995 (tid 0x2b0e208796e0): repl ctx 1: Using init_resync_snapid 1433317767:1886. Total snap count = 2, curent snap cnt = 0.
Etter noen minutter, det normale løpet av mrepl_sends Begynner å vises:
09/21 11:19:04.136 (tid 0x327e760): repl ctx 1:3: mrepl_send_file: file 30:0:ac66:0:a30e9f46:556eb187:1d74 took 218 sec, net throughput 297 KB/s, virtual throughput 290 KB/s, refs_sent 7575, refs_features_sent 0, segs_sent 0, segs_features_sent 7575, size 63416832, vbytes 63416832, nbytes 64858812 (recid 361) (ch-xor 0x98f3c7e9) (hole_seen FALSE) 09/21 11:19:59.031 (tid 0x2b0e2083cde0): repl ctx 1:16: mrepl_send_file: file 30:0:ac68:0:fccc10a6:556eb187:1d74 took 237 sec, net throughput 286 KB/s, virtual throughput 280 KB/s, refs_sent 7908, refs_features_sent 0, segs_sent 0, segs_features_sent 7908, size 66419200, vbytes 66419200, nbytes 67938672 (recid 363) (ch-xor 0x462a1211) (hole_seen FALSE)
Den neste forekomsten av vbytes_remain Viser en annen størrelse:
09/21 11:28:02.246 (tid 0x2b0e096ba050): repl ctx 1: mrepl_stats_local: vbytes_remain: 92036838018199
Cause
Resolution
Slik utformes replikering for å beregne de logiske bytene som er igjen. Dette misforholdet observeres hver gang brukeren begynner å kopiere en eldre MTREE. Dette indikerer imidlertid ikke at MTREE-replikering replikerer dette for data, det replikerer bare gjeldende størrelse på MTREE som angitt av init_vbytes_remain.
Når initialiseringsfasen er over, tilbakestiller du vbytes_remain til 0 og oppdater også vbytes_written_and_replicated med cum_raw_bytes Så påfølgende sikkerhetskopier viser ikke urealistisk statistikk, men rapporterer bare de nye dataene som er inntatt.